    Description: 
I observed huge heap occupation on large grid installation including 136 
nodes/1k caches.

Example from machine with 64g heap:

{noformat}
 num     #instances         #bytes  class name
----------------------------------------------
   1:       897287977    43069822896  java.util.HashMap$Node
   2:       9273162    14866180592  [Ljava.util.HashMap$Node;
   3:       201282292    4830775008    java.lang.Integer
   4:       6247215    983811096      [Ljava.lang.Object;
   5:       3383402    767741664      [C
   6:       12188    669411952       [B
   7:       9923859   635126976       java.util.HashMap
...
{noformat}

Further investigation had showed the heap is polluted during exchange process, 
which involves creating many hashmaps occupying large amounts of memory.

Proposal: use other datastructures to help keep heap usage low.
